A life of vision, effort, and opportunity
Ed passed away on March 21, 2026, leaving behind a remarkable business legacy and an even greater personal one.
Born in Highwood, Illinois, to Italian immigrant parents, Ed’s life reflected the American Dream. His father worked first as a coal miner and later as a landscaper, and his mother worked as a housemaid. Through determination, talent, and perseverance, Ed carved an exceptional path for himself and for those around him.
As a recipient of the Chick Evans Caddie Scholarship, he attended and graduated from Northwestern University. He began his professional career as a toy salesman before ultimately finding his calling in the municipal bond industry, where he would build a career spanning more than five decades.
After co-founding Columbian Securities in the early 1960s, Ed founded Bernardi Securities in 1984. What began as a bold personal and professional risk became a highly respected firm known for discipline, expertise, and trusted relationships.
From modest beginnings, Ed truly maximized life.

Selected milestones
Early 1960s: Co-founded Columbian Securities, beginning a long and distinguished career in the municipal bond business.
1984: Founded Bernardi Securities to pursue his vision for an independent, highly respected municipal bond firm.
Career of 50+ Years: Built a reputation for excellence in the municipal bond market and served in leadership roles across civic, charitable, and industry organizations.
Later Years: Authored two historical fiction novels, The Reluctant Patriot and Kill the Devil Twice.
